For three years Swedish pop star Robyn had an identity crisis when she was a teen - her teachers thought she was a boy.

Her name and short-haired look made it difficult for the 'With Every Heartbeat' singer to convince others she was a girl - and her mother had to write to her school to correct one teacher.

Robyn says, "My handicrafts teacher thought I was a boy for three years. I tried to tell her I was a girl, but she'd say, 'My little boy wanted to be a girl when he was a kid, too.'

"Finally, my mum had to write her a note that said, 'Please don't assume that Robyn is a boy anymore because she's a girl'."

And the mistaken identity issue is still one that lingers - especially in America, where Robyn is touring with Katy Perry this summer.

She tells Out magazine, "I get mistaken for a lesbian all the time - but I guess I do have the most lesbian haircut of any of the girls in my field."
